Welsh Cakes or “Pice ar y maen” in the Welsh are basically very similar to a fruit scone, only they aren’t cooked in the oven they are cooked on a griddle or in a heavy based frypan. They contain Currants rather than Sultanas as traditionally many people had better access to Blackcurrants than they did Grape Vines in Wales.

Yes, yes, I know Wales has Grapevines to but thats only due to people being able to affordabley have greenhouses and to varieties now produced that do better in soggy and frosty regions. When my Nana was about that was not the case, so Currant Bushes it was.

Ingredients

250g / 10 ozs Self Raising Flour or Plain Flour + 1 tsp Baking Powder

A Pinch of Mixed Spice

1/2 tsp Baking Powder

125g / 5 ozs Butter

75g / 3ozs Castor Sugar or Superfine Sugar (NOT Icing Sugar)

50g / 2 ozs Dried Currants

1 Egg

5 tspns Milk

Oil for cooking IF prefered (I don’t use it I prefer jsut the hot griddle so did Nana)

Method

  1. Mix Flour, Salt, Mixed Spice and Baking Powder together in a large mixing bowl

2. Rub in the Butter gently until it looks like soft breadcrumbs

3. Add the Milk and Egg and mix until you get a soft but fairly stiff dough

4. Roll out to 5mm/ 1/4inch thick

5. Use a 3 inch cookie cutter and cut out rounds.

6. Reroll leftover dough and keep cutting out rounds until all the dough is used up.

7. Cook over a medium heat for approximately 3 minutes on each side.

8. Toss in Sugar afterwards while still hot.

9. Serve as is or with Butter
